    About the Opportunity:

    Reporting to the Controller, the Senior Accountant will be responsible for managing all aspects of the organization’s financial operations. With the use of GAAP, they will perform various complex accounting activities and financial analysis, including, but not limited to, budget development; fiscal interpretation and analysis; preparing financial reports; performing account reconciliations; and various accounting duties. They will oversee the full cycle of bookkeeping, payroll, and grant reporting functions, including accounts payable, accounts receivable, expense allocations, and the monthly close.

    What You’ll Do:

    Reporting to the Controller, the Senior Accountant will be responsible for, but not exclusive to the following:

    Accounting Operations

    • Audit and Compliance:
      • Organize and maintain audit schedules (balance sheet & income statement).
      • Support annual audit and 990 reports by adhering to organizational accounting policies and procedures throughout the year and by providing the Audit firm with the required reports and backup.
      • Ensure timely compliance with federal, state, and local financial legal requirements.
    • Accounts Payable and Receivable:
      • Work independently to process accounts payable and accounts receivable in a timely manner.
      • Manage vendor relationships, including tax exemption requests and dispute resolutions.
      • Gathering of W9’s and appropriately tracking vendors for 1099 status.
    • Financial Records Management:
      • Maintain and secure financial records in accordance with GAAP.
      • Enter payroll journal entries and allocation journal entries.
      • Assist in the management and maintenance of financial software systems (e.g., QuickBooks, Bill.com).
    • Month-End and Year-End Close:
      • Complete month-close process, including bank reconciliations and reporting entries.
      • Collaborate with the finance team to ensure accurate and timely financial reporting.

    Operations Support

    • Policy and Procedures:
      • Help the team maintain efficient and effective accounting and financial management infrastructure including policies, processes, procedures and internal controls.
      • Prepare and recommend accounting policies and procedures to strengthen internal controls.
    • Financial Analysis:
      • Monitor, analyze, and interpret financial trends to support effective decision-making, identify areas for improvement, and ensure the organization’s financial sustainability.
      • Work with the team to prepare the organizational, program and grant budgets based on budget performance and cash flow.
    • Special Projects and Support:
      • Provide backup support in areas like cost reallocation and compliance.
      • Assist with managing various requirements such as license renewals, lobbying expense reporting, sales tax refund claims, etc.
      • Other special projects and responsibilities as assigned, while meeting tight deadlines and prioritize accordingly.
      • Be the liaison of the Finance team and work collaboratively with a variety of personalities.
      • Attend organizational events as requested.

    The Senior Accountant will also assist with ad hoc projects and tasks as required to support the finance team and overall business needs.
